Clock Drawing Exam
Psychologists use clock drawing checks (CDTs) as part of cognitive evaluation to detect early dementia in family and friends. It's an easy, noninvasive, and widely accepted means for screening cognitive decline caused by dementia or other reversible circumstances like depression, delirium or psychological health issues. A CDT involves members to draw clocks on paper indicating a specific time (generally 10 minutes earlier eleven). You can find a variety of scoring techniques utilized for CDTs; professionals sometimes offer you pre-drawn circles working with "palms" in lieu of figures in order to avoid providing hints about attainable deficiencies or failing the check entirely.

Determined by its scoring strategy, clock drawing exams can assess many areas of cognitive operate such as Visible and verbal memory, spatial arranging (drawing numbers and palms within their correct spots), executive purpose and visuo-spatial deficits. They may be widely viewed as an early indicator of dementia as they exhibit up deficits in visuo-spatial functions and govt working that point out early signs of dementia.

Clock drawing assessments ought to occur in an environment freed from distraction, so request your liked a single to take a seat at a desk with plain, eight.five-by-11-inches paper and producing implement in front of them. Success needs to be out there right away: a very normal clock suggests cognitive, motor, and perceptual capabilities are intact indicating they most likely Will not have problems with dementia even though any markedly irregular clock indicates more analysis may be necessary.

Delayed Recall Take a look at
Psychologists offer many psychological tests intended to detect early dementia. These may entail thoughts relating to memory, trouble solving talents and attention competencies to assist your health care provider in detecting no matter if early signs and symptoms of Alzheimer's or A further problem which include depression exist; On top of that they could rule out likely causes such as strokes or brain fluid retention as opportunity sources of cognitive decline.

The most frequently utilized assessments is the Montreal Cognitive Evaluation (MoCA). This brief and painless take a look at can be finished immediately within your health care provider's Workplace and comprises 11 issues meant to assess seven domains of cognitive operate. MoCA scores are decided applying instant and delayed recall, with scores below 24 currently being indicative of cognitive impairment. New studies have demonstrated that MoCA performs better at detecting MCI than its rival MMSE check.

A paired sample t-check for CVLT-3 free of charge and cued delay recall performances uncovered considerable versions amongst MCI members and balanced controls, with significant differences seen in between their recall performances on these responsibilities and people observed to acquire MoCA scores in spite of scoring metrics utilized, although retrieval efficiency only linked to CVLT-3 cued delays.

People who rating inadequately on these exams might be referred to a neurologist for further tests, like blood exams to detect amyloid or tau levels - indicators of Alzheimer's sickness. Other probable biomarkers could incorporate MRI scans or genetic testing that detect gene variants associated with autosomal dominant Alzheimer's. New assessments are in advancement which could allow extra correct diagnoses in long term.

Mini-Psychological Condition Assessment (MMSE)
The Mini Mental State Examination (MMSE) is definitely an obtainable examination designed to diagnose dementia and Alzheimers that assessments your ability to monitor time, spot, notice, calculation, recall and language skills in only 10 minutes. It can be an invaluable technique for screening early cognitive impairment.

MMSE may be the go-to psychological evaluation Instrument for dementia, with scores down below 24 signifying impaired cognition. Age, training and ethnicity normative details is obtainable to interpret somebody's MMSE score additional successfully.

Scientific tests have demonstrated the usefulness in the MMSE for dementia screening; having said that, final results range widely determined by both examiner proficiency and restrictions in screening strategies.

The Mini Mental Condition Evaluation (MMSE) is easy to administer, but it need to be scored by someone skilled in its administration and scoring in accordance with rigorous protocols. The first MMSE was first developed in 1975 but may possibly put up with bad inter-rater reliability; SMMSE (Standardized Mini Mental Condition Evaluation) was designed in 1997 with specific administration and scoring Guidance designed to decrease variability of complete scores across a populace. Neuropsychological Exams
Neuropsychological analysis is a lot more in-depth as opposed to MMSE, including memory, pondering and language checks to ascertain no matter if an individual's cognitive decrease can be attributable to dementia - in addition to which stage it would be at. The exam outcomes support doctors make correct diagnoses.

Neuropsychological checks use objective and standardized measures of focus, language comprehension, visuospatial notion, episodic memory and govt functionality. Their scores are then in contrast in opposition to norms customized especially for each person according to age, amount of education and learning and demographic details to be able to gauge any discrepancies from what was anticipated depending on someone's age, education and learning amount or demographic properties - to be able to accurately evaluate any deviations between reality and expectations.

These tests should be carried out periodically to monitor how somebody's cognitive and purposeful qualities change with time, providing clinicians with important data when formulating medication treatment plans for patients.

Blood checks may assistance evaluate no matter if Alzheimer's is current in a person's program. These blood tests should only be thought of Element of an Over-all assessment; further evaluations like CT or PET scans to begin to see the Mind construction in addition to lumbar punctures with or without spinal faucets to test cerebrospinal fluid for protein biomarkers of Alzheimer's or other varieties of dementia ought to also be conducted to ensure that an correct picture.
